Subject: l2tp: add missing .owner to struct pppox_proto

From: Wei Yongjun <yongjun_wei@x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x>

[ Upstream commit e1558a93b61962710733dc8c11a2bc765607f1cd ]

Add missing .owner of struct pppox_proto. This prevents the
module from being removed from underneath its users.

Signed-off-by: Wei Yongjun <yongjun_wei@x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x>
Signed-off-by: David S. Miller <davem@xxxxxxxxxxxxx>
Signed-off-by: Greg Kroah-Hartman <gregkh@x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x>
---
 net/l2tp/l2tp_ppp.c |    3 ++-
 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)

--- a/net/l2tp/l2tp_ppp.c
+++ b/net/l2tp/l2tp_ppp.c
@@ -1778,7 +1778,8 @@ static const struct proto_ops pppol2tp_o
 
 static const struct pppox_proto pppol2tp_proto = {
 	.create		= pppol2tp_create,
-	.ioctl		= pppol2tp_ioctl
+	.ioctl		= pppol2tp_ioctl,
+	.owner		= THIS_MODULE,
 };
 
 #ifdef CONFIG_L2TP_V3
